@charset "UTF-8";:root{--primary-white:#F8F5F0;--primary-black:#333333;--primary-gray:#EFEAE4;--primary-blue:#131951;--primary-orange:#D97B41;--primary-green:#B8C3A8;--section-padding:64px 3.46%;scroll-padding:20px}body{font-family:"BIZ UDPGothic",Roboto,Arial,sans-serif;font-style:normal;color:var(--primary-black,#333);background-color:var(--primary-white,#f8f5f0);line-height:2}.font-size-L{font-size:clamp(3.2rem,2.637rem + 2.4vw,4.8rem)}.font-size-M{font-size:clamp(2.4rem,1.837rem + 2.4vw,3.2rem)}.font-size-S{font-size:clamp(1.6rem,1.318rem + 1.2vw,2.4rem)}img{max-width:100%;height:auto}a{text-decoration:none;display:inline-block}.anchor{display:inline-block}.SpBr{display:inline-block}.TABBr{display:none}.pcBr{display:none}@media screen and (min-width:768px){.SpBr{display:none}.TABBr{display:inline-block}}@media screen and (min-width:1024px){.TABBr{display:none}.pcBr{display:inline-block}:root{--section-padding:120px 8.3%}}.plan__subTitle{color:var(--primary-green,#b8c3a8);font-family:Roboto;font-weight:400;line-height:1.5;margin-left:.5em}.plan__titleWrapper{display:flex;align-items:center}.plan__terms{background-color:var(--primary-white,#f8f5f0);border:1px solid var(--primary-blue,#131951);transition:.5s cubic-bezier(.45,0,.55,1);padding:32px 1.5em;margin:24px auto 0;display:inline-block;width:100%;display:none}.plan__termsTitle{color:var(--primary-blue,#131951);font-family:"BIZ UDPGothic";font-weight:800;line-height:1.5}.plan__list{margin-bottom:32px}.plan__item{padding:12px 0 12px;border-bottom:1px solid var(--primary-blue,#131951)}.plan__item:first-of-type{margin-top:0}.plan__nameWrapper{display:flex;align-items:center}.plan__icon{width:1.5em;height:auto;aspect-ratio:1/1;filter:brightness(0) saturate(100%) invert(44%) sepia(11%) saturate(1418%) hue-rotate(348deg) brightness(95%) contrast(92%)}.plan__name{margin-left:.5em;color:var(--primary-blue,#131951);font-family:"BIZ UDPGothic";font-weight:800;line-height:1.5}.plan__categoryList{display:flex;align-items:center}.plan__categoryName{color:var(--primary-blue,#131951);font-family:"BIZ UDPGothic";font-weight:800;line-height:1.5;display:inline-block;margin-right:.5em}.plan__itemList,.plan__tagList{margin-top:16px}@media screen and (min-width:768px){.plan__terms{padding:48px 2.25em;margin-top:40px}.plan__list{margin-bottom:48px}.plan__item{padding:20px 0 20px;display:flex}.plan__itemList{margin-top:0;display:flex;gap:.5em;width:76%}.plan__itemList li{display:inline-block}.plan__nameWrapper{width:24%}}.plan__termsButtonWrapper{display:flex;align-items:center;gap:1em;margin-top:40px}.plan__termsButton{background-color:var(--primary-orange,#d97b41);padding:.5em 3.5em .5em .5em;position:relative;cursor:pointer}.planButton__name{color:var(--primary-white,#f8f5f0)}.plan__result{margin-top:64px}.plan__categoryTitleWrapper{display:flex}.plan__categoryTitle{color:var(--primary-blue,#131951);font-family:"BIZ UDPGothic";font-weight:800;line-height:1.5}.plan__categoryIcon{display:inline-block;width:clamp(1.6rem,1.318rem + 1.2vw,2.4rem);height:auto;aspect-ratio:1/1;object-fit:contain;filter:brightness(0) saturate(100%) invert(43%) sepia(30%) saturate(538%) hue-rotate(348deg) brightness(94%) contrast(91%);margin-right:.5em}.plan__resultWrapper{display:flex}.plan__resultContent{margin-top:40px}.plan__resultCategory{margin-top:40px}.plan__resultList{margin-top:24px}.plan__resultItem{margin-top:24px;padding:32px 1.5em;border:1px solid var(--primary-blue,#131951);background-color:#fff;position:relative;max-width:400px;transition:.5s cubic-bezier(.45,0,.55,1)}.plan__resultItem:active{transform:translateY(-10px)}.plan__link{position:absolute;width:100%;height:100%;top:0;left:0}.planImg{height:100%;width:100%;object-fit:cover;aspect-ratio:1/1;max-height:240px}.planImg img{height:100%;width:100%;object-fit:cover;aspect-ratio:1/1}.planItem__txtWrapper{margin-top:24px}.planItem__name{color:var(--primary-black,#333);font-family:"BIZ UDPGothic";font-weight:800;line-height:1.5}.planItem__tagList{display:flex;align-items:center;gap:.5em;margin-top:8px}.plan__price{margin-top:8px}.planItem__price{font-size:clamp(1.6rem,1.318rem + 1.2vw,2.4rem);font-weight:800;margin-top:16px}@media screen and (min-width:768px){.plan__resultList{margin-top:48px;display:flex;gap:2%}.plan__resultItem{margin-top:0;width:32%}.plan__resultItem:hover{transform:translateY(-10px)}.plan__resultContent{margin-top:64px}.plan__resultCategory{margin-top:64px}.plan__price,.post-categories li{margin-top:12px}.plan__resuliList{display:flex;gap:5%}.plan__item{width:30%}.planItem__txtWrapper{margin-top:40px}}